PHONETICS:
- Clothes /kləʊðz/ - cost /kɒst/ - dollar / ˈdɒlə/ - done /dʌn/ - honest / ˈɒnɪst/ - loan /ləʊn/ - money /ˈmʌnɪ/ - note /nəʊt/ - nothing /ˈnʌθɪŋ/  - owe /əʊ/ - shopping / ˈʃɒpɪŋ/ - some /sʌm/ - sold /səʊld/ - won /wʌn/ - worry /ˈwʌrɪ/
- The thin ´mother thought about that theatre  ə θɪn ˈmʌðə θɔːt əˈbaʊt ðæt ˈθɪətə/
- Cook /kʊk/ - food /fuːd/ - fruit /fruːt/ - good /gʊd/ - juice /ʤuːs/ -  took  /tʊk/- soup /suːp/ - Spoon /spuːn/ - sugar /ˈʃʊgə/ - book/bʊk/
- Beer /bɪə/ - bear /beə/ - beard /bɪəd/

Reading guide for ANOTHER WORLD, chapters 7 + 8

Questions for Chapter 7
50.How many brothers had Eve got?
51.Why was BZ embarrassed when he met Eve´s brothers?
52.Who´s Miranda?
53.When he was in the bathroom, did BZ have positive or negative thoughts about Eve´s family?
54.Why did BZ feel so bad when he saw Eve´s father?
55.What was the maximum age for people in Eden City?
56.What does this sentence mean: “On their twenty-fifth birthday, people went happily to the Long Dream”?
57.What did BZ think about Even when he saw her mother?
58.What did BZ ask  Eve when he went out of Eve´s family house?
59.What was Eve´s reaction?
  
Questions for Chapter 8
60.What did BZ do when he came back to Eden City?
61.Can you explain the content included in BZ´s subject “The Law of the Long Dream”?
62.Did BZ accept the idea of this “long dream”?
63.What was Eve´s real name?
64.Where did she go to be interviewed when she came back from the real world?
65.Why did Eve consider very good BZ´s reactions in the real world?
66.Why did Eve take BZ to the real world?
67.Can you explain the end of the book? Do you think Eve is going to accept the Long Dream? Or do you think she will go to the real world before her 25th birthday?
